Pinus mugo Winter Gold 30-40 CM C15
Pinus mugo ‘Wintergold’ is a compact, slow-growing dwarf mountain pine prized for its vivid winter colour: dense needle foliage turns rich golden-yellow in the colder months, returning to green in summer. Forming a neat mound and requiring little maintenance, it’s ideal for rock gardens, gravel gardens and containers, bringing valuable winter interest. Grow in full sun in well-drained soil (sandy or loamy, preferably neutral to acidic) and avoid waterlogging. Eventually reaches around 1–1.5 m in height and spread; fully hardy (RHS H7).
